EGG-LAYING.

THE CHRISTCHURCH COMPETITION.

[PfiESS ASSOCIATION.]

CHRISTCHURCH, January 22. The statement for the 38th week of the New Zealand Utility Poultry Club's egglaying competition at Lincoln College shows that 665 eggs were laid during the week, making the total to date 24,823. Following are' the best totals for the week : C. Petersen's Black Orpingtons 31. H. P. Pocock's Black Orpingtons 27; Alexandra Poultry Company's White Plymouth Rocks 27. Totals to date are : H. Hawke, Silver Wyandottes, 988; J. Mann, White Wyandottes, 874: J. H. Shaw, Brown Leghorns, 839; R. E. M. Evans, Silver Wyandottes, 783.
